At Mondial, we’re proud fundraisers who believe great conversations can change the world. For over 20 years, we’ve partnered with leading charities to deliver best-practice telephone fundraising- focused on quality, respect and donor-centric outcomes. We’re proud members of the Fundraising Institute Australia (FIA) and are recognised in the sector for a quality-first, donor-centric approach.

Working with long-standing clients such as UNICEF Australia, Starlight Children's Foundation, New Zealand Red Cross, Australia for UNHCR, Plan International Australia, the McGrath Foundation, Mission Australia and HRI, our team is passionate about delivering exceptional campaigns and long-term results. Our culture is collaborative, inclusive and driven by learning, innovation and impact.

About the role

As Client Services Manager , you’ll sit at the heart of Mondial’s client partnerships- managing integrated fundraising projects, overseeing campaign delivery, analysing performance and building trusted relationships that stand the test of time.

This is a hands-on role where you’ll own your work end-to-end, collaborate closely with internal teams and charity partners, and continuously look for opportunities to optimise results and add value.

In this key role, you will:
  • Manage and grow strong, long-term client relationships built on trust and results
  • Deliver telephone fundraising campaigns from briefing through to post-campaign evaluation
  • Develop integrated strategies aligned to client objectives across Regular Giving, Retention and Gift in Wills
  • Analyse and interpret campaign data to provide meaningful insights and recommendations
  • Oversee timelines, budgets and deliverables to ensure campaigns run on time and on budget
  • Prepare client documentation including proposals, reports and briefing materials
  • Stay informed on fundraising trends and contribute learnings across the business
About you

You're the kind of person who notices when a campaign is tracking 8% under forecast and wants to know why. You can read a pivot table and a call transcript with equal comfort. You’re organised, detail-oriented and relationship-driven. You enjoy juggling multiple projects, translating data into insights and working closely with clients to help them succeed. You’re curious, proactive and bring a genuine passion for fundraising and purpose-led work.

Most importantly, you value quality, teamwork and continuous learning- just like we do.

You bring:
  • 1–3 years’ experience in fundraising, account management, project management or a related field
  • Strong project management sk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ities
  • Confidence analysing and interpreting data to inform decision-making
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• A collaborative mindset and strong stakeholder management capability
  • High attention to detail and a proactive, solutions-focused approach
  • A genuine interest in charity fundraising and donor-centred outcomes
